Ionic liquid ferrofluids based on mixtures of [Emim][EtSO4] and [Bmim][NO3] fuels and hydroxylamonium nitrate oxidizer were synthesized by adding iron oxide nanoparticles. The resulting propellants were then tested for decomposition capability. Aluminum (Al) has been widely used in micro-electromechanical systems (MEMS), polymer bonded explosives (PBXs) and solid propellants. Its typical core-shell structure (the inside active Al core the external alumina (Al2O3) shell) determines its oxidation process, which is mainly influenced by oxidant diffusion, Al2O3 crystal transformation melt-dispersion of Al. Plasticizers are compounds which add to solid propellants’ formulations to improve their mechanical properties. These materials have key role in the control of mechanical properties. 2,4-Dinitrotoluene (2,4-DNT) is one of the most important plasticizers of double based propellants.
